The Tiny House Collaborative in Washington State

Saul Rip - a fellow Washingtonion - is part of an exciting start up to create an ongoing educational tiny house project. Saul and his team are working to empower high schools with an opportunity to offer a tiny house building curriculum to students to enable them to connect with communities and learn new skills in the process. The Collaborative plans to do this by creating a sharable set of tools that include a start-to-finish tiny house construction video. These tools will also be available to the wider community of tiny house enthusiasts so if you're considering building a tiny house at some point be sure give this project some attention. Learn more at the Collaborative Tiny House Project.
